I was vaping alot more last week. I was felling a little funny so i thought I was getting to much. I do have some stuff made in the USA. White Rhine brand.

Clay you may right and have been getting a bit nic sick. Its happened to lots of us. If that's the case you need to take a break. As some-one mentioned, you also need to stay hydrated and you'll need to drink more water than usual. It also doesn't hurt to have some eliquid with a lower nic concentration that you can use sometimes. Overdoing it with the nic has happened to lots of people.

If you want to try to get off the cigs completely I suggest you try a 24mg nicotine. I smoked 2 packs a day and was able to comfortably quit by using 24mg. It took the cravings away and I didn't have withdrawls. I suspect your still needing to smoke because your nicotine is too low. As for the headaches, I'm not sure the cause. Could be the juice or could be trying to quit smoking. But I'd increase your nicotine and see if that helps with quitting the smokes. It could possibly help your headaches too. I know everyone is different but because your still getting the urge to smoke it could be tied to your nicotine levels. Hope this helps. You can always lower the nicotine once you get pass the hump of not smoking. Best wishes .

Glad it's better. There's a huge transition when going from cigarettes to vaping. I experienced multiple side effects. Headache was one. I found out I was vaping way way more than I ever smoked and at the higher (24 mg at that time) levels of nicotine that seemed to cause most of it. DRINK WATER. I found what lowering nicotine and increasing water helped LOADS and LOADS….of course YMMV. I hope you find out what's causing it. Good luck to you.

[edited] 90% of eliquid used worldwide is from China. Modern vaping was invented in China. Based on first hand examination by ECF members, the larger Chinese eliquid manufacturers have very clean working environments.

Considering some small eliquid manufacturers mix it in their kitchens, bathrooms and garages, it is just as possible that a "closer to home" maker could sell less than sanitary eliquid.
